Wood pellet boiler

The high efficiencies and low
particulate emissions claimed by
Hoval for its STU biomass boilers are
the result of thermally efficient
design, advanced controls and high
quality wood pellet fuel produced to
the EN+ standard.
Testing of the STU 195 wood pellet boiler by TÜV has confirmed efficiencies to 92% with an average of 3mg/MJ for particulate emissions, achieved through a combination of inverter controlled fuel feed augers and responsive induced air flow, regulated by a robust, strategically located lambda probe. Combustion is optimised by a Flametronix PLC based touchscreen control system.
